Engine Size and Power

The engine size and power of a Honda Grom directly impact its top speed. The Grom comes with a compact but peppy 125cc engine. While this engine is designed for efficiency and agility rather than raw power, there are still ways to enhance its performance. Upgrading to a larger engine or increasing the engine’s power through modifications can significantly improve the Grom’s top speed.

One popular modification for increasing engine power is installing a big bore kit. This involves replacing the stock cylinder with a larger one, increasing the displacement of the engine. The increased displacement allows for more fuel-air mixture to be burned, resulting in a boost in power and ultimately higher top speeds.

Gear Ratio and Transmission

The gear ratio and transmission setup of a Honda Grom can significantly impact its top speed. The Grom comes with a standard that features a range of gears to accommodate various riding conditions. However, modifying the gear ratio can optimize the bike’s performance for higher speeds.

One popular modification for increasing top speed is changing the sprocket sizes. A larger rear sprocket or a smaller front sprocket can alter the gear ratio, allowing the Grom to achieve higher speeds at the cost of some acceleration. Conversely, a smaller rear sprocket or a larger front sprocket can improve acceleration but may limit the bike’s top speed.

It’s important to find the right balance between acceleration and top speed when modifying the gear ratio. Consider your riding style and preferences to determine the optimal gear ratio setup for your Honda Grom.

ECU Tuning

ECU tuning is another modification that can unlock the full potential of your Honda Grom’s top speed. The Engine Control Unit (ECU) is responsible for managing various aspects of the engine’s performance, including fuel injection, ignition timing, and throttle response. By reprogramming the ECU, you can optimize these parameters to enhance the overall performance of your bike.

ECU tuning involves modifying the ECU’s software to adjust fuel and ignition maps, throttle response curves, and other engine parameters. This allows you to fine-tune your Honda Grom’s performance to suit your specific riding style and preferences. With proper ECU tuning, you can achieve a smoother power delivery, improved throttle response, and ultimately, a higher top speed.

Braking and Handling

Proper braking and handling techniques are crucial for maintaining control and stability when riding at high speeds. Here are some to help you improve your braking and handling skills:

  1. Braking Technique: When braking, apply both the front and rear brakes gradually and smoothly. Avoid abrupt or harsh braking, as it can cause loss of control. Practice using both brakes simultaneously to distribute the braking force evenly.
  2. Body Positioning: Maintain a balanced and relaxed body position while riding. Gripping the tank with your knees helps stabilize the bike and allows for better control during braking and cornering.
  3. Cornering: When cornering at high speeds, lean into the turn while keeping your body relaxed and your eyes focused on the desired line. Gradually apply the brakes before entering a corner and smoothly accelerate as you exit.
  4. Suspension Setup: Ensure that your Honda Grom’s suspension is properly adjusted to handle high-speed riding. Consult the owner’s manual or a professional technician to optimize your suspension settings based on your weight and riding style.

By practicing and mastering these braking and handling techniques, you can significantly improve your control and stability when riding at high speeds.

Tire Selection and Maintenance

Choosing the right tires and maintaining them properly is vital for safe and reliable high-speed riding. Here are some to consider when it comes to tire selection and :

  1. Tire Type: Opt for high-quality sport or performance tires that are specifically designed for motorcycles. These tires offer better grip, stability, and cornering performance at high speeds. Consider such as tread pattern and compound to ensure optimal performance.
  2. Tire Pressure: Regularly check and maintain the tire pressure according to the manufacturer’s recommendations. Proper tire pressure ensures optimal traction, handling, and stability. Insufficient or overinflated tires can compromise your safety and affect the bike’s performance.
  3. Tire Tread and Condition: Inspect your tires regularly for signs of wear, cuts, or punctures. Replace worn-out or damaged tires immediately to avoid compromising your safety. A sufficient tread depth is essential for optimal grip, especially on wet or slippery surfaces.
  4. Balancing and Alignment: Ensure that your tires are properly balanced and aligned. Imbalanced or misaligned tires can cause vibrations, instability, and uneven tire wear. Regularly check and adjust the balance and alignment to maintain optimal performance.

Remember, tires are the only contact points between your Honda Grom and the road. Choosing the right tires and maintaining them properly will enhance your safety, improve , and provide a more enjoyable riding experience.
